AUSTIN, Texas — A man has died in the hospital after police say a car hit him late Saturday evening.

The pedestrian, identified as 23-year-old Devon Reed Gerald, was transported to South Austin Medical Center where he later succumbed to his injuries. Gerald was pronounced at 9:35 p.m. on the evening of Feb. 17.

The preliminary investigation shows that a silver 2013 Toyota Highlander was traveling eastbound on West Slaughter Lane approaching the intersection of Southpark Meadows Drive with a green light.

Gerald ran across Slaughter, from north to south, against the pedestrian traffic light and was struck by the Toyota. The driver of the Toyota remained on scene.
